  1. 1Confirm size or breed restrictions directly with the hotel before booking, pet-friendly policies here vary in the details even when the property is listed as accepting pets.

  4. 4Pack your dog's usual bedding, most of these stays welcome pets but don't necessarily provide pet amenities beyond a smoke-free, air-conditioned room to sleep in.
